  2.  Summary of the Spanish Driving License System Spain operates under a tiered driving license system, classified based on vehicle type and specs. Comprehending these categories is important for those seeking to drive legally within the country.
  3.  Driving License Categories Classification Vehicle Type Age Requirement Period of Validity AM Mopeds (up to 50cc) 15 years 10 years A1 Motorbikes (up to 125cc) 16 years 10 years A2 Motorbikes (over 125cc) 18 years Ten years B Automobiles (as much as 3,500 kg) 18 years Ten years B+E Cars with trailers 18 years Ten years C Trucks (over 3,500 kg) 21 years 5 years D Buses 24 years 5 years Necessary Steps to Obtain a Spanish Driving License Identify Eligibility: Ensure you satisfy the age requirement and have the needed paperwork, including residency status in Spain and possible health checks.
  4.  Pass a Vision Test: A vision test is mandatory before continuing with your application. This can be done at any licensed driving school or medical center.
  5.  Participate In Theory Classes: While not needed by law, attending driving school is recommended. It will prepare candidates for the theory test, which covers roadway indications, traffic laws, and security standards.
  6.  Take the Theory Exam: This multiple-choice exam tests your knowledge of Spain's traffic policies. Applicants should score at least 30 correct responses out of 40 concerns.
  7.  Complete Practical Driving Lessons: Upon passing the theory test, candidates should finish a set number of practical driving lessons. This action is essential for comprehending useful applications of traffic laws.
  8.  Pass the Practical Driving Test: Successfully navigate a series of driving maneuvers within a set time while sticking to traffic policies. This test is conducted by an inspector from the local traffic authority.
  9.  Receive Your Licenses: After passing both tests and completing needed documentation, candidates will be provided a provisional license up until the official file shows up.
  10.  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s) 1. What documents do I need to get a Spanish driving license? You normally need your DNI/NIE (national or foreign ID), proof of residency, a medical certificate, and a passport-sized photo.
  11.  2. Can I drive in Spain with a foreign driving license? Yes, however only for a limited time. EU licenses are usually accepted, while non-EU holders may require an International Driving Permit (IDP).

  13.  4. What are the expenses related to obtaining a driving license in Spain? Costs may differ, but expect to budget for theory and practical lessons, exam fees, and associated documentation, totaling approximately EUR500-EUR1,000.
  14.  5. Is it possible to convert a foreign driving license to a Spanish one? Yes, depending upon the nation of origin. Numerous EU nations have an easy conversion process, while others might require you to go through the entire testing process.
